TL;DR Summary

The leading 4-year CD rate has dropped from 5.20% to 5.13% APY, signaling a decline in longer-term CD rates. However, the overall top rate remains at 5.88% APY for a 7-month term. The Federal Reserve's future rate increases are uncertain, but CD rates are expected to plateau near their current levels unless the Fed raises rates again. Jumbo CD rates have also seen changes, with All In Credit Union offering the highest rate of 5.80% APY for an 18-month term.
